Advantages of Cold Mix Asphalt





Cold mix asphalt provides a ecologically lasting and cost-effective option for roadway construction and maintenance. One vital advantage of chilly mix asphalt is its flexibility. Unlike warm mix asphalt, which needs heats during laying and mixing, cool mix asphalt can be utilized in lower temperature levels, making it ideal for cool weather problems or emergency repair services. This flexibility enables year-round roadway upkeep and building activities, decreasing downtime and making sure smoother traffic circulation (asphalt repair).


Another advantage of cold mix asphalt is its ease of application. Since it can be stockpiled and used as required without the need for home heating tools, it streamlines the construction process and lowers power usage. In addition, cool mix asphalt is extra forgiving throughout application, enabling for longer workability and much easier compaction contrasted to hot mix asphalt.


Additionally, cool mix asphalt provides excellent resilience and resistance to water penetration, leading to longer-lasting road surfaces. Its ability to stick to existing pavement surface areas makes it a prominent selection for pothole repair services and pavement preservation tasks. On the whole, the advantages of chilly mix asphalt make it a reliable and sensible service for sustainable roadway framework development.


Environmental Benefits





With a concentrate on sustainability and eco-friendliness, the ecological benefits of utilizing cold mix asphalt in roadway construction and upkeep are significant. Cold mix asphalt manufacturing needs reduced temperature levels contrasted to hot mix asphalt, causing lowered power usage and lower greenhouse gas emissions. This procedure aids in saving power resources and decreasing the carbon footprint related to road building and construction jobs. Additionally, cold mix asphalt is usually generated using recycled products such as recovered asphalt pavement (RAP) and recycled asphalt roof shingles (RAS) By incorporating these recycled products, chilly mix asphalt helps to decrease the amount of waste sent out to land fills and promotes an extra circular economic climate within the construction market. The lower manufacturing temperature levels of cold mix asphalt also contribute to improved air quality by reducing the release of unstable organic substances (VOCs) and other unsafe discharges into the atmosphere. On the whole, the environmental advantages of cold mix asphalt make it a lasting option for environment-friendly and lasting roadway framework.




Easy Application and Maintenance



Effective application and upkeep treatments play a vital function in the successful application of chilly mix asphalt for road construction projects. Cold mix asphalt offers a significant benefit in terms of simple application compared to hot mix asphalt. Given that cool mix asphalt does not call for heating throughout the blending procedure, it can be stocked and used at ambient temperatures. This simplifies the application process, reducing the power intake and discharges connected with typical hot mix asphalt manufacturing.


Upkeep of roads constructed with cool mix asphalt is additionally a lot more uncomplicated. Cold mix asphalt has improved versatility and sturdiness, enabling it to hold up against fluctuations in temperature and rush hour loads without fracturing as quickly as conventional warm mix asphalt. When maintenance is called for, cold mix asphalt can be quickly reapplied to damaged locations without the need for comprehensive preparation or customized tools. This simplicity of upkeep assists prolong the lifespan of roadways, reducing total maintenance costs and reducing interruptions to website traffic flow. Overall, the very easy application and maintenance of chilly mix asphalt make it a sensible and lasting choice for lasting roadway building tasks.
